Summary
Death toll from back-to-back Venezuela earthquakes rises to 920, with thousands reported missing. Some 4,300 people were injured and thousands were reported missing across the country. People sleep in the streets a day after an earthquake and several aftershocks struck Caracas, Venezuela.
